Evora is a pretty nice city, protected by Unesco and defined as a World Heritage. Allow 4 hours at least to visit this city. |
Templo romano (The roman temple) Built in the acropolis, a relic of architecture in the Corinthian style, a unique example in Portugal (2nd-3rd century AD) |
Capela dos ossos (The bones chapel) It is inside "Igreja de S. Francesco" and it has been made with the bones of 5000 monks. They gathered the bones buried in 42 monastic cemeteries to make this. |
